Myrtle Beach vacation rental home tips:

Money saving strategies:

  • The sooner your group can reserve a vacation home, the easier your search will be. The best properties are booked early. Reserving your rental property 6-12 months before your travel dates is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to search for and reserve your rental property.
  • Booking in Fall or Spring months is our best tip for saving money on your vacation rental. Rates are lower, and you'll find a larger selection of acceptable properties. Many vacationers use this method to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a special rate.
  • Booking websites often offer renters an option to add v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which generally will cost an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ed vacation time as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Often, rental management companies supply Myrtle Beach area visitor guide magazines which will include money-saving deals, either offered directly by local companies, or by way of a partnership between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Myrtle Beach vis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

During your stay:

  • We recommend storing the host's contact information in your smartphone.
  • Property managers are available to help! Don't be shy to ask questions during your stay.
  • Lock your rental while you are out. Protect your property!
  • Upon arrival, record any damages to the rental property and immediately contact the owner. Keep records of all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Don't forget to respect your neighbors. Often, surrounding homes are occupied by local residents. Respecting noise limits and parking policies can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can often point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to see a beautiful sunrise or sunset, have a great night out,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• When it's time to leave, take a walk-through to make sure you didn't forget anything. Make sure to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den items.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Inspect the property a final time and scan for any damage. We advise inspecting the property with the property manager whenever possible. If the host is not available, take photographs of the rental to record its condition.
  • Remember to leave feedback! Hosts rely on good reviews to drive future reservations. They'll be grateful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Please be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to solve it.
